Interchangeable pyrography nibs

The two main types of pyrography pens are fixed and interchangeable. Attached tips come with fixed pens. These are ideal for beginners. Interchangeable pens let you change your tips to fit any project. Both are quick and efficient. A set of 53 bresstaps and 12 stencils can make it easier to switch to an interchangeable pen. There are many sizes to choose from, and you can get both large and tiny nibs.

Chisel tips

If you are interested in pyrography, one of the best tools to use is a chisel tip. These tools can be used to shade small areas of wood, or create repetitive lines and markings. They can even be bent to make stamped shapes. The chisel points for pyrography can be used to add texture and color to your images. You can also use a variety if tips for different styles or burnt wood.


Razertip's chisel pyrography tip is a great tool for repeating lines and fine detail. They can be bent to fit tight spaces and can also be used for shading uneven surfaces. You can also find them in curved spear tips, shader tips, or writing tips. These tips can be used in a variety of ways, but all are useful for writing and scribbling.

Multi-use pyrography tips

The wood burning kit will include a variety pyrography nibs. You can choose from medium, large, extra-large and small tips, depending on the effect you want. Many pyrography artists have multiple sizes and shapes to choose from for various styles and applications. It is a good idea to start out with a few different sizes, and gradually increase your collection as your skills improve.

Wood burning pens include a variety tips that can be interchanged with other tools. Each tip is ideal for a specific job and can be swapped out. Universal tips are good for beginning artists as they can be used for both outlining and lettering. Rounded flow tip are excellent for lettering. Calligraphy is best for more complex cursive text. You can also find other tips for advanced woodburners.

What woods are suitable for making furniture?

Woods can be classified according to how hard they are. Softwoods can be pine, fir or cedar. Because they resist rot, softwoods can be used to make outdoor furniture. The hardwoods include teak, maple, mahogany and oak. Because they are not weather-resistant, they are best used indoors.
